Exposing Defects: The Art of Software Testing

Software development is a meticulous process, needing unwavering attention to detail. While developers strive for perfection, particularly the most skilled programmers can inadvertently introduce errors into their code. These elusive mistakes, known as bugs, can have unpredictable consequences for software applications. To mitigate these risks, a dedicated and methodical approach is required: software testing.

Software testing is an integral part of the development lifecycle, acting as a critical safeguard against faulty code. It involves a comprehensive battery of techniques designed to identify and rectify defects before they reach end users. Testers employ a variety of strategies, including automated testing, to guarantee that software applications function as intended.

The art of software testing lies in the ability to think like a user and anticipate potential problems. Testers must possess a keen eye for detail and a strong commitment to quality. By diligently uncovering bugs, testers play a crucial role in delivering robust and reliable software solutions.

Automating Test Cases : Streamlining Quality Assurance

In today's fast-paced software development world, ensuring high quality is paramount. Automating tests has emerged as a critical practice for streamlining the quality assurance cycle. By employing automated test scripts, development teams can execute tests rapidly and reliably, detecting bugs early in the build cycle. This proactive approach not only enhances software robustness but also lowers the time and resources required for manual testing.

The benefits of automated testing are extensive. It enables faster feedback loops, detects defects more effectively, and reduces the risk of human error. Furthermore, automated tests can be performed repeatedly to ensure uniformity in software behavior across different environments.

  • As a result, automated testing has become an indispensable tool for modern development practices, helping organizations deliver high-quality software applications that meet user expectations.

Mastering Test Cases

Writing effective test cases is vital for confirming the quality of your software. A comprehensive set of test cases can help you identify bugs early on, avoid costly revisions, and ultimately produce a more reliable product. To achieve true test case mastery, follow these principles. First, always start with a clear understanding of your software's design. This will help you define the specific features and functionalities that need to be tested.

Next, consider different validation scenarios. Think about how users might utilize your software in various ways, and design test cases that cover a wide range of possibilities. Don't forget to consider negative test cases, which test for invalid input and potential errors. Finally, document your test cases clearly and concisely. This will help you follow up on the progress of testing and streamline collaboration among team members.

Impact of Exploratory Testing

Exploratory testing is a adaptive approach to software quality assurance that empowers testers to investigate into the software without predefined test cases. Testers are directed by their intuition and curiosity, constantly evaluating the system's behavior. This open-ended approach reveals unexpected flaws that might be overlooked by traditional, formal testing methods. Exploratory testing is a crucial tool for optimizing software quality and guaranteeing that it meets user expectations.
